Cleanup RTCv1 register names
This commit is contained in:
parent
419e4aa9fe
commit
706d803b17
@ -1,148 +1,168 @@
|
|||||||
---
|
---
|
||||||
block/RTC:
|
block/RTC:
|
||||||
description: Real time clock
|
description: Real-time clock
|
||||||
items:
|
items:
|
||||||
- name: CRH
|
- name: CRH
|
||||||
description: RTC Control Register High
|
description: Control Register High
|
||||||
byte_offset: 0
|
byte_offset: 0
|
||||||
fieldset: CRH
|
fieldset: CRH
|
||||||
- name: CRL
|
- name: CRL
|
||||||
description: RTC Control Register Low
|
description: Control Register Low
|
||||||
byte_offset: 4
|
byte_offset: 4
|
||||||
fieldset: CRL
|
fieldset: CRL
|
||||||
- name: PRLH
|
- name: PRLH
|
||||||
description: "RTC Prescaler Load Register High"
|
description: Prescaler Load Register High
|
||||||
byte_offset: 8
|
byte_offset: 8
|
||||||
access: Write
|
access: Write
|
||||||
fieldset: PRLH
|
fieldset: PRLH
|
||||||
- name: PRLL
|
- name: PRLL
|
||||||
description: "RTC Prescaler Load Register Low"
|
description: Prescaler Load Register Low
|
||||||
byte_offset: 12
|
byte_offset: 12
|
||||||
access: Write
|
access: Write
|
||||||
fieldset: PRLL
|
fieldset: PRLL
|
||||||
- name: DIVH
|
- name: DIVH
|
||||||
description: "RTC Prescaler Divider Register High"
|
description: Prescaler Divider Register High
|
||||||
byte_offset: 16
|
byte_offset: 16
|
||||||
access: Read
|
access: Read
|
||||||
fieldset: DIVH
|
fieldset: DIVH
|
||||||
- name: DIVL
|
- name: DIVL
|
||||||
description: "RTC Prescaler Divider Register Low"
|
description: Prescaler Divider Register Low
|
||||||
byte_offset: 20
|
byte_offset: 20
|
||||||
access: Read
|
access: Read
|
||||||
fieldset: DIVL
|
fieldset: DIVL
|
||||||
- name: CNTH
|
- name: CNTH
|
||||||
description: RTC Counter Register High
|
description: Counter Register High
|
||||||
byte_offset: 24
|
byte_offset: 24
|
||||||
fieldset: CNTH
|
fieldset: CNTH
|
||||||
- name: CNTL
|
- name: CNTL
|
||||||
description: RTC Counter Register Low
|
description: Counter Register Low
|
||||||
byte_offset: 28
|
byte_offset: 28
|
||||||
fieldset: CNTL
|
fieldset: CNTL
|
||||||
- name: ALRH
|
- name: ALRH
|
||||||
description: RTC Alarm Register High
|
description: Alarm Register High
|
||||||
byte_offset: 32
|
byte_offset: 32
|
||||||
access: Write
|
access: Write
|
||||||
fieldset: ALRH
|
fieldset: ALRH
|
||||||
- name: ALRL
|
- name: ALRL
|
||||||
description: RTC Alarm Register Low
|
description: Alarm Register Low
|
||||||
byte_offset: 36
|
byte_offset: 36
|
||||||
access: Write
|
access: Write
|
||||||
fieldset: ALRL
|
fieldset: ALRL
|
||||||
fieldset/ALRH:
|
fieldset/ALRH:
|
||||||
description: RTC Alarm Register High
|
description: Alarm Register High
|
||||||
fields:
|
fields:
|
||||||
- name: ALRH
|
- name: ALRH
|
||||||
description: RTC alarm register high
|
description: Alarm register high
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 16
|
bit_size: 16
|
||||||
fieldset/ALRL:
|
fieldset/ALRL:
|
||||||
description: RTC Alarm Register Low
|
description: Alarm Register Low
|
||||||
fields:
|
fields:
|
||||||
- name: ALRL
|
- name: ALRL
|
||||||
description: RTC alarm register low
|
description: Alarm register low
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 16
|
bit_size: 16
|
||||||
fieldset/CNTH:
|
fieldset/CNTH:
|
||||||
description: RTC Counter Register High
|
description: Counter Register High
|
||||||
fields:
|
fields:
|
||||||
- name: CNTH
|
- name: CNTH
|
||||||
description: RTC counter register high
|
description: Counter register high
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 16
|
bit_size: 16
|
||||||
fieldset/CNTL:
|
fieldset/CNTL:
|
||||||
description: RTC Counter Register Low
|
description: Counter Register Low
|
||||||
fields:
|
fields:
|
||||||
- name: CNTL
|
- name: CNTL
|
||||||
description: RTC counter register Low
|
description: Counter register low
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 16
|
bit_size: 16
|
||||||
fieldset/CRH:
|
fieldset/CRH:
|
||||||
description: RTC Control Register High
|
description: Control Register High
|
||||||
fields:
|
fields:
|
||||||
- name: SECIE
|
- name: SECIE
|
||||||
description: Second interrupt Enable
|
description: Second interrupt enable
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
- name: ALRIE
|
- name: ALRIE
|
||||||
description: Alarm interrupt Enable
|
description: Alarm interrupt enable
|
||||||
bit_offset: 1
|
bit_offset: 1
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
- name: OWIE
|
- name: OWIE
|
||||||
description: Overflow interrupt Enable
|
description: Overflow interrupt enable
|
||||||
bit_offset: 2
|
bit_offset: 2
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
fieldset/CRL:
|
fieldset/CRL:
|
||||||
description: RTC Control Register Low
|
description: Control Register Low
|
||||||
fields:
|
fields:
|
||||||
- name: SECF
|
- name: SECF
|
||||||
description: Second Flag
|
description: Second flag
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
- name: ALRF
|
- name: ALRF
|
||||||
description: Alarm Flag
|
description: Alarm flag
|
||||||
bit_offset: 1
|
bit_offset: 1
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
- name: OWF
|
- name: OWF
|
||||||
description: Overflow Flag
|
description: Overflow flag
|
||||||
bit_offset: 2
|
bit_offset: 2
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
- name: RSF
|
- name: RSF
|
||||||
description: "Registers Synchronized Flag"
|
description: Registers synchronized flag
|
||||||
bit_offset: 3
|
bit_offset: 3
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
- name: CNF
|
- name: CNF
|
||||||
description: Configuration Flag
|
description: Configuration flag
|
||||||
bit_offset: 4
|
bit_offset: 4
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
|
enum: CNF
|
||||||
- name: RTOFF
|
- name: RTOFF
|
||||||
description: RTC operation OFF
|
description: RTC operation OFF
|
||||||
bit_offset: 5
|
bit_offset: 5
|
||||||
bit_size: 1
|
bit_size: 1
|
||||||
|
enum: RTOFF
|
||||||
fieldset/DIVH:
|
fieldset/DIVH:
|
||||||
description: "RTC Prescaler Divider Register High"
|
description: Prescaler Divider Register High
|
||||||
fields:
|
fields:
|
||||||
- name: DIVH
|
- name: DIVH
|
||||||
description: "RTC prescaler divider register high"
|
description: Prescaler divider register high
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 4
|
bit_size: 4
|
||||||
fieldset/DIVL:
|
fieldset/DIVL:
|
||||||
description: "RTC Prescaler Divider Register Low"
|
description: Prescaler Divider Register Low
|
||||||
fields:
|
fields:
|
||||||
- name: DIVL
|
- name: DIVL
|
||||||
description: "RTC prescaler divider register Low"
|
description: Prescaler divider register low
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 16
|
bit_size: 16
|
||||||
fieldset/PRLH:
|
fieldset/PRLH:
|
||||||
description: "RTC Prescaler Load Register High"
|
description: Prescaler Load Register High
|
||||||
fields:
|
fields:
|
||||||
- name: PRLH
|
- name: PRLH
|
||||||
description: "RTC Prescaler Load Register High"
|
description: Prescaler load register high
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 4
|
bit_size: 4
|
||||||
fieldset/PRLL:
|
fieldset/PRLL:
|
||||||
description: "RTC Prescaler Load Register Low"
|
description: Prescaler Load Register Low
|
||||||
fields:
|
fields:
|
||||||
- name: PRLL
|
- name: PRLL
|
||||||
description: "RTC Prescaler Divider Register Low"
|
description: Prescaler divider register low
|
||||||
bit_offset: 0
|
bit_offset: 0
|
||||||
bit_size: 16
|
bit_size: 16
|
||||||
|
enum/CNF:
|
||||||
|
bit_size: 1
|
||||||
|
variants:
|
||||||
|
- name: Exit
|
||||||
|
description: Exit configuration mode (start update of RTC registers)
|
||||||
|
value: 0
|
||||||
|
- name: Enter
|
||||||
|
description: Enter configuration mode
|
||||||
|
value: 1
|
||||||
|
enum/RTOFF:
|
||||||
|
bit_size: 1
|
||||||
|
variants:
|
||||||
|
- name: Enabled
|
||||||
|
description: Last write operation on RTC registers is still ongoing
|
||||||
|
value: 0
|
||||||
|
- name: Disabled
|
||||||
|
description: Last write operation on RTC registers terminated
|
||||||
|
value: 1
|
||||||
|
Loading…
x
Reference in New Issue
Block a user